On the Merit of Observations Beyond the Cluster Core

Abstract
I discuss recent seminal work on the LARCS dataset: a panoramic study of rich clusters of galaxies at z~0.12. The importance of observing beyond the cluster core is illustrated by exploiting these data to examine colour gradients across the clusters.
